Jira issue numbers increase not 1 by 1

Andrey Kabakov
November 12, 2019

Hi, all!

After issues amount  reached 10000 in one of our project next issues are created with any numbers more than 10000, but numbers change not 1 by 1. Now we have more 20000 numbers in issue keys and approximately 1500 new issues. I checked logs and didn't find anything.  It happens only in one projects. In MySQL table "project" parameter pcounter for this project increases continuously. Thanks.

The matter is concluded  in mail handler work. Some letters contained "smiles", so they couldn't be transformed to Jira issues. But "pcounter" in "project" table was being continuously updated. After letters deletion the problem was fixed.
